Exposing the Myth of Cleaning Harder for Cleaner Pearly Whites



Don't think the myth that brushing harder will certainly cause cleaner teeth. Lots of people believe that using more stress while cleaning will certainly get rid of more plaque and germs from their teeth. Nonetheless, this isn't real, and actually, it can be unsafe to your oral health.

Cleaning also hard can damage your tooth enamel and aggravate your gums, leading to level of sensitivity and gum tissue recession. The key to reliable cleaning isn't force, but method and uniformity.

It's recommended to make use of a soft-bristled toothbrush and mild, round activities to clean all surfaces of your teeth. Furthermore, cleaning for at the very least 2 minutes two times a day, together with normal flossing and dental check-ups, is necessary for preserving a healthy smile.

Common Dental Myths: What You Required to Know



Do not be tricked by the myth that sugar is the primary culprit behind tooth decay and dental caries.

While it holds true that sugar can add to dental troubles, it isn't the sole reason.



Dental cavity takes place when hazardous bacteria in your mouth feed upon the sugars and starches from the foods you take in.

These bacteria produce acids that wear down the enamel, bring about dental caries.

However, inadequate oral health, such as inadequate brushing and flossing, plays a substantial function in the growth of dental caries as well.

In addition, specific variables like genes, completely dry mouth, and acidic foods can additionally contribute to oral issues.
